How to Clean and Replace Air Filters Effectively
Regular AC maintenance keeps your system efficient, and a key part of that is dealing with the air filters. Let’s explore how you can clean and replace them effectively, ensuring your home remains a sanctuary.
Identify your air filter types: Check if they’re reusable or disposable. Knowing this will guide your cleaning techniques or replacement schedule.
Turn off your AC: Safety first—always switch off your system before handling filters.
Use appropriate cleaning techniques: Rinse reusable filters with water, let them dry completely. Don’t skip this step!
Replace disposable filters: Follow the manufacturer’s recommendations for frequency and type.
Checking and Maintaining Your AC’s Refrigerant Levels
An essential aspect of maintaining your AC's efficiency is checking and maintaining its refrigerant levels. You know how important it is to keep your home comfortable, and guaranteeing your AC runs smoothly plays a big part. If your system's refrigerant levels aren't sufficient, it can't cool effectively, leading to higher energy bills and discomfort. Be on the lookout for refrigerant leaks, which can cause significant issues if left unaddressed. Subtle signs like a hissing sound or reduced cooling performance might be clues. If you suspect a leak, don't hesitate to call a professional to guarantee everything stays in perfect harmony.
Inspecting and Cleaning the Condenser Coils
After ensuring your refrigerant levels are in check, it's equally important to focus on the condenser coils. Clean coils enhance condenser efficiency, ensuring your AC runs smoothly. Here's how you can do it yourself:
Power Down: Always turn off the unit before starting the coil cleaning process.
Remove Debris: Gently remove leaves, dirt, and other debris around the condenser.
Clean the Coils: Use a soft brush or a vacuum to clean the coils carefully, ensuring you don't damage them.
Fin Comb: Straighten any bent fins using a fin comb to optimize airflow.
